A Lorawan transceiver is a communication device specifically designed for use in Lorawan networks. This transceiver enables devices to communicate with one another and with a Lorawan gateway, facilitating efficient and long-range communication for Internet of Things (IoT) applications. In this article, we will discuss the structure, features, and benefits of a Lorawan transceiver in detail.

1. Structure of a Lorawan Transceiver:
A Lorawan transceiver typically consists of two main components: a Lorawan modem and a radio frequency (RF) module. The Lorawan modem handles the protocol stack, including encryption and decryption, while the RF module is responsible for transmitting and receiving signals over the air.

2. Features of a Lorawan Transceiver:
Long Range: One of the key features of a Lorawan transceiver is its ability to provide long-range communication. This is achieved through the use of low power, wide area (LPWA) technology, which allows devices to communicate over several kilometers, even in rural or underground areas.
Low Power Consumption: Lorawan transceivers are designed to operate on low power, making them ideal for battery-powered IoT devices. The transceiver uses a sleep and wake-up mode, ensuring minimal power consumption when the device is idle.
Secure Communication: Lorawan transceivers provide end-to-end encryption, ensuring secure communication between devices and gateways. This is crucial in protecting sensitive data transmitted over the network.
Scalability: Lorawan transceivers support a large number of devices on a single network, making them highly scalable. This allows for the efficient deployment of IoT applications across various industries.

3. Benefits of Using a Lorawan Transceiver:
Cost-effective: Lorawan transceivers are cost-effective, allowing for the widespread adoption of IoT applications. The low power consumption and long-range capabilities of these devices also contribute to cost savings.
Interoperability: Lorawan transceivers are designed to be interoperable with different IoT applications and network infrastructure, ensuring seamless integration and communication between devices.
Easy Deployment: Lorawan transceivers can be easily deployed, thanks to their plug-and-play capabilities. The devices can be quickly installed and connected to existing Lorawan networks, reducing deployment time and complexity.
Reliable Communication: Lorawan transceivers provide reliable and robust communication, even in challenging environments. The long-range capabilities and error correction mechanisms ensure that data is transmitted accurately and without loss.

Lorawan transceivers play a pivotal role in enabling efficient and scalable communication for IoT applications. With their long-range capabilities, low power consumption, and secure communication features, these transceivers provide the foundation for the successful deployment of IoT solutions across various industries. As the IoT market continues to grow, the demand for Lorawan transceivers is expected to increase, driving advancements and innovations in this field.
